Find if user is in a call or not?

Update for Swift 2.2: you just have to safely unwrap currCall.currentCalls.

import CoreTelephony
let currCall = CTCallCenter()

if let calls = currCall.currentCalls {
    for call in calls {
        if call.callState == CTCallStateConnected {
            print("In call.")
        }
    }
}

Previous answer: you need to safely unwrap and to tell what type it is, the compiler doesn't know.

import CoreTelephony
let currCall = CTCallCenter()

if let calls = currCall.currentCalls as? Set<CTCall> {
    for call in calls {
        if call.callState == CTCallStateConnected {
            println("In call.")
        }
    }
}

iOS 10, Swift 3

import CallKit

/**
    Returns whether or not the user is on a phone call
*/
private func isOnPhoneCall() -> Bool {
    for call in CXCallObserver().calls {
        if call.hasEnded == false {
            return true
        }
    }
    return false
}

Or, shorter (swift 5.1):

private var isOnPhoneCall: Bool {
    return CXCallObserver().calls.contains { $0.hasEnded == false }
}
